Kronnenbourg 1664


This first sip leaves you with the impression that something magical is about to happen, then....nothing does. It seems to me a better than average beer at first taste, a slight bite and semi-tout flavor seems enticing at first, but a strange yet subtle aftertaste left me unsure about how to guage this unique flavor. So I did what any good Christian would do, I drank another. Relatively the same reaction flowed from my tongue to my brain and only after my 4th one, it was decided.....I'm done.

 

This beer review does not depend on stars, or quality count, taste, nah. What I describe is from my  unique taste alone and can only hope that you will formulate your own opinion of the beers reviewed here

BeerFacts

The familiar Bass symbol, a red triangle, was registered in 1876 and is the world's oldest trademark.
